Output 6498fb91fd5569ba553e5bf08c5caa074b2e2bb29083d156cb0bf1beadcb181d:1

value
16713285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a56b3f593f319a1029aecb409fc96e9de6fd8de9 OP_EQUAL
address
3GmftsyJLu3LctARe2nA2qvCG5co5Lf2Nf
transaction
6498fb91fd5569ba553e5bf08c5caa074b2e2bb29083d156cb0bf1beadcb181d
confirmations
188650
spent
true